Output ebda2b73456ddd170729fb0fd3ab8fa4b60678ff2aaa4d920cc894bfbdfedd5e:0

value
5142200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4eea2c5ff35252492aea46af166308518bb8a6b OP_EQUAL
address
3Gj6ciGb6fKsSqTaELfNMVAdKxrkJp8Vow
transaction
ebda2b73456ddd170729fb0fd3ab8fa4b60678ff2aaa4d920cc894bfbdfedd5e
confirmations
372971
spent
true